Known Issues
|
|
------------
|
|
|
|
- Upgrading from BIND 9.16.32 or any older version may require a manual
|
|
configuration change. The following configurations are affected:
|
|
|
|
- ``type primary`` zones configured with ``dnssec-policy`` but without
|
|
either ``allow-update`` or ``update-policy``,
|
|
- ``type secondary`` zones configured with ``dnssec-policy``.
|
|
|
|
In these cases please add ``inline-signing yes;`` to the individual
|
|
zone configuration(s). Without applying this change, :iscman:`named`
|
|
will fail to start. For more details, see
|
|
https://kb.isc.org/docs/dnssec-policy-requires-dynamic-dns-or-inline-signing

- BIND crashes on startup when linked against libuv 1.36. This issue is
|
|
related to ``recvmmsg()`` support in libuv, which was first included
|
|
in libuv 1.35. The problem was addressed in libuv 1.37, but the
|
|
relevant libuv code change requires a special flag to be set during
|
|
library initialization in order for ``recvmmsg()`` support to be
|
|
enabled. This BIND release sets that special flag when required, so
|
|
``recvmmsg()`` support is now enabled when BIND is compiled against
|
|
either libuv 1.35 or libuv 1.37+; libuv 1.36 is still not usable with
|
|
BIND. :gl:`#1761` :gl:`#1797`

- UDP network ports used for listening can no longer simultaneously be
|
|
used for sending traffic. An example configuration which triggers this
|
|
issue would be one which uses the same address:port pair for
|
|
``listen-on(-v6)`` statements as for ``notify-source(-v6)`` or
|
|
``transfer-source(-v6)``. While this issue affects all operating
|
|
systems, it only triggers log messages (e.g. "unable to create
|
|
dispatch for reserved port") on some of them. There are currently no
|
|
plans to make such a combination of settings work again.
